Teen charged over Ballan fatal crash

Detectives from Major Collision Investigation Unit have charged a 17-year-old boy following a fatal crash in Ballan, Victoria Police say.

The crash occurred on the Western Highway about 2.30pm yesterday after a short pursuit where an allegedly stolen van crashed into two trucks.

The 17-year-old faced an out of sessions hearing this evening and has been charged with culpable driving, dangerous driving causing death, conduct endangering life, theft of motor vehicle, aggravated burglary, burglary and other offences.

He has been remanded to appear at a Children’s Court at a later date.
